S-P-A-C-E-D O-U-T …Modelling Space!!
Harry was unique, having a vision that the activity should be shared with the rest of the World. In 1962, Harry Stine presented the Federation Aeronautique Internationale (FAI) with details of what was internationally to become known as Space Modelling and at the same time drafted out some conceptual rules for competitions. 1964 enabled the Commission International d’Aeromodelisme (CIAM) of FAI, ratify these proposals and Space Modelling took its place alongside F1-Free Flight, F2-Control Line and F3-Radio Control Aero Models, as a recognised Airsport.
